When TIG welding, there are three choices of welding current. They are: Direct Current Straight Polarity (DCSP), Direct Current Reverse Polarity (DCRP), and Alternating Current with or without High Frequency

The ultimate TIG gas flow - Welding Tips and Tricks
Jan 11, 2021 · There is no mathematical formula that can dictate conditions accurately enough to determine flow requirements. Differing ambient temperature, cylinder pressures, regulator quality, joint configuration, etc.. all play an integral part of "flow".
